THERAPEUTIC INDICATIONS:
Tinidazole is an antibiotic that is used to treat certain types of vaginal infections (bacterial vaginosis, trichomoniasis). It is also used to treat certain types of parasite infections (giardiasis, amebiasis). It works by stopping the growth of certain bacteria and parasites.This antibiotic treats only certain bacterial and parasitic infections. It will not work for viral infections (such as common cold, flu). Using any antibiotic when it is not needed can cause it to not work for future infections.

Introduction to Tinidazole Tablets 500mg
Tinidazole Tablets 500mg belong to the class of antiprotozoal medicines widely prescribed to treat infections caused by protozoa such as trichomoniasis, giardiasis, and amebiasis. Additionally, it is also used to treat bacterial vaginosis in adult women.
Tinidazole works by entering the protozoa and bacteria, where it interferes with DNA synthesis, leading to the destruction of the microorganism.

Medical Uses & Global Demand
-
Primary Uses:
-
Trichomoniasis: A sexually transmitted disease that can affect both men and women.
-
Giardiasis: An intestinal infection causing diarrhea, stomach cramps, and bloating.
-
Amebiasis: Caused by Entamoeba histolytica, leading to abdominal pain and diarrhea.
-
Bacterial Vaginosis: Vaginal infection in adult women.
-
-
Dosage Guidelines:
-
Best taken with food to avoid stomach-related side effects such as nausea and cramps.
-
Available as single-dose or multiple-day therapy depending on infection type.
-
-
Contraindications & Safety:
-
Not recommended during pregnancy (especially the first trimester).
-
Breastfeeding should be avoided for 72 hours after a single dose.
-
Common side effects include nausea, dizziness, loss of appetite, headaches, and abdominal cramps.
-

Top 20 FAQs
Q1. What are Tinidazole Tablets 500mg used for?
They are used to treat trichomoniasis, giardiasis, amebiasis, and bacterial vaginosis.
Q2. How does Tinidazole work?
It interferes with DNA synthesis in protozoa and bacteria, leading to their death.
Q3. Can Tinidazole be taken with food?
Yes, it is recommended to take Tinidazole with food to reduce stomach upset.
Q4. Is Tinidazole safe during pregnancy?
Not recommended during pregnancy; consult your doctor.
Q5. Can breastfeeding women take Tinidazole?
No, women should avoid breastfeeding for 72 hours after taking Tinidazole.
Q6. What are the side effects?
Nausea, vomiting, headache, dizziness, abdominal cramps, and loss of appetite.
Q7. Can Tinidazole impair fertility?
Studies in animals suggest possible fertility impairment, though human data is limited.
Q8. How long does Tinidazole take to work?
It usually starts working within a few hours, but symptoms improve in 1–2 days.
Q9. Can children take Tinidazole?
Yes, but only under strict medical supervision.

Q12. Can Tinidazole be taken as a single dose?
Yes, some infections require a single-dose therapy, while others need multiple days.
Q13. What precautions should be taken?
Avoid alcohol during treatment and for 3 days after.
